In the following diagram if 'x' is a neutral point, identify the magnetic poles A and B. explain your answer.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

(i) Definition of null point
(ii) The magnetic lines of force are directed from the north pole to south pole of a magnet. Null points are obtained when two magnetic fields cancel each other at a point.
